Jeonnam Youth Future Foundation Holds Cultural Festival Event in Jangseong
A Festival Where Youth and Local Residents Come Together
Various Performances and Activities Including Dance, Instrumental Music, and Games
The Jeonnam Youth Future Foundation held the 'Jeonnam Youth Culture Festival' event on the 19th at the Jangseong-gun Youth Training Center.
[Photo by Jeonnam Youth Future Foundation]
The Jeollanam-do Youth Future Foundation hosted the 'Jeollanam-do Youth Culture Festival' on the 19th in Jangseong to bridge cultural gaps between regions and provide youth and local residents with an opportunity to enjoy culture.
Held in collaboration with the Jangseong County Youth Center, the event took place in the center's front yard, where approximately 800 youths and local residents gathered to enjoy youth performances such as dance and musical instrument playing, along with various experiences and games at 66 booths.
A youth participant from the youth planning group said, "I felt proud that the festival prepared by youths became an event where both youths and local residents could enjoy together."
Director Yang Miran stated, "We aim to continue expanding opportunities for Jeonnam youth to actively participate in various fields, contributing to youth growth and sustainable regional development alongside local residents."

Hosted by Jeonnam Province and organized by the Youth Future Foundation, the '2024 Jeollanam-do Youth Culture Festival' was held in Suncheon and Gwangyang in August and is scheduled to take place in Yeosu on the 26th and in Yeonggwang on November 9.
